The Waikato district has much to offer. It is strategically located in the centre of the North Island's prosperous 'golden triangle'. It is linked from north to south, east to west by the Waikato Expressway and major rail links to two major seaports. Our people provide a highly-trained, resident workforce and have easy access to some of the world's best training and research institutions.
And while the Waikato is just a short drive from two major cities, our residents enjoy idyllic lifestyles in some of New Zealand's most beautiful and historic locations.

Natural Resources

Waikato is rich in natural resources including water, soils, minerals and forestry. Their ease of availability anchor the district's major industries including agriculture, energy and manufacturing. The district takes the management of these resources seriously. At both a district and regional level, councils are active in ensuring the resources are used in an environmentally sustainable way and with respect for cultural traditions and quality of life enjoyed by residents.
